New Year's Eve gala is canceled in Lima

6/16/2004

LIMA, Ohio - Citing low participation levels, officials with the Lima Symphony Orchestra and the downtown civic center have canceled this year's New Year's Eve gala.

The gala was started in 2001 in the wake of the cancellation of Lima's family-oriented First Night celebration, which was held for two years but scrapped because of financial and managerial concerns.

For the past three years, New Year's Eve revelers could attend the gala, which included dinner, dancing, and a symphony concert. Civic Center Director Brian Keegan said this week that organizers are looking for alternatives.
